
Eleven motorists suspected of driving under the influence of alcohol were arrested by the EMPD during roving roadblocks in the region over the weekend.
Conducted by members of the EMPD Public Order Policing Unit, the roadblocks were held from just after midnight on Saturday to noon on Sunday.

According to EMPD spokesperson Chief Supt Wilfred Kgasago, four drivers were arrested in Katlehong, two in Tembisa, two in Germiston and one each in Putfontein, Brakpan and Tokoza.
“All the male arrestees, aged between 22 and 41, were detained and are expected to appear before a magistrate soon to face charges of driving under the influence of alcohol,” he said.
